Microservices

NVIDIA Introduces NIM Microservices for Improved Pep Talk and also Translation Functionalities

.Lawrence Jengar.Sep 19, 2024 02:54.NVIDIA NIM microservices deliver enhanced pep talk and interpretation components, allowing smooth combination of AI models right into applications for a worldwide viewers.
NVIDIA has unveiled its own NIM microservices for pep talk as well as translation, aspect of the NVIDIA artificial intelligence Business collection, according to the NVIDIA Technical Blog Site. These microservices enable developers to self-host GPU-accelerated inferencing for both pretrained and also tailored AI designs around clouds, data facilities, and workstations.Advanced Pep Talk and Translation Features.The new microservices make use of NVIDIA Riva to supply automatic speech awareness (ASR), nerve organs machine interpretation (NMT), and text-to-speech (TTS) capabilities. This assimilation aims to enhance global consumer adventure as well as ease of access by incorporating multilingual vocal capabilities into applications.Developers can easily make use of these microservices to develop customer service robots, involved voice assistants, and also multilingual content systems, enhancing for high-performance artificial intelligence inference at scale along with low growth attempt.Active Internet Browser Interface.Users may do standard inference jobs including recording pep talk, equating message, and also creating man-made vocals directly through their browsers making use of the active user interfaces accessible in the NVIDIA API magazine. This feature supplies a convenient beginning point for checking out the capabilities of the pep talk and translation NIM microservices.These tools are flexible sufficient to become set up in several environments, from regional workstations to overshadow and also information center facilities, producing them scalable for varied implementation demands.Operating Microservices along with NVIDIA Riva Python Clients.The NVIDIA Technical Blogging site particulars just how to duplicate the nvidia-riva/python-clients GitHub database and make use of provided manuscripts to manage easy inference tasks on the NVIDIA API catalog Riva endpoint. Customers need an NVIDIA API trick to get access to these orders.Examples offered consist of translating audio documents in streaming method, translating text coming from English to German, and also generating synthetic speech. These tasks illustrate the efficient applications of the microservices in real-world cases.Setting Up Locally with Docker.For those with enhanced NVIDIA information facility GPUs, the microservices may be dashed regionally using Docker. Detailed guidelines are actually offered for putting together ASR, NMT, and TTS solutions. An NGC API key is actually called for to take NIM microservices coming from NVIDIA's compartment pc registry and function them on local area devices.Integrating with a RAG Pipe.The blog post likewise deals with just how to connect ASR and also TTS NIM microservices to a general retrieval-augmented production (WIPER) pipeline. This create allows customers to submit records into an expert system, talk to concerns verbally, and also obtain solutions in synthesized voices.Directions include setting up the atmosphere, launching the ASR as well as TTS NIMs, and setting up the dustcloth internet app to quiz large language styles by content or even voice. This assimilation showcases the ability of integrating speech microservices with innovative AI pipes for enriched consumer interactions.Beginning.Developers considering incorporating multilingual pep talk AI to their applications can begin through discovering the pep talk NIM microservices. These devices supply a seamless method to combine ASR, NMT, as well as TTS into various platforms, offering scalable, real-time voice solutions for an international viewers.For more information, visit the NVIDIA Technical Blog.Image source: Shutterstock.